Recent Developments in Lisburn
Lisburn has seen several exciting developments in its green spaces recently. The council has been focusing on upgrading existing parks and creating new recreational areas. One notable project is the transformation of the former golf course into a multi-use park. This project includes the construction of new walking and cycling paths, a community garden, and a playground. The new park will provide a much-needed green space for residents and enhance the overall quality of life in the area.
Additionally, the council has been working on improving access to green spaces for all residents. This includes the development of new footpaths and cycle routes, as well as the installation of benches and seating areas. These improvements aim to make green spaces more accessible and enjoyable for everyone, regardless of age or mobility.
